SNOW GLOBE SEAHORSE!

You have probably seen the Still Scenes stamps and the Snowglobe Scenes dies in the Holiday Catalogue along with the Snowglobe Shaker Domes.  These make fun Christmas cards and we had a great time using them in a class recently.  You can use these products not just at Christmas time.  I was looking around on Pinterest and found some fun ideas using other occasions stamps.

For this one I used the Seaside Notions stamp set to make a fun snowglobe.

To make this I diecut the circular shape with the die in the set on the white card then embossed it with the Swirls and Curls Embossing Folder.  I used a small piece of white card and traced the circular shape on to the white card in pencil so I could see the area to stamp on to.  Then adhere one of the Shaker domes in to the embossed white card from behind.

The images were stamped on the scrap white card in Memento and coloured with the Stampin’ Blends.

To assemble the card the stamped white piece was adhered on to the Seaside Spray Card mat.  Then carefully add a little glitter. I used the Ice Stampin’ Glitter and also some Snowflake Sequins. Remove the backing off the Snowglobe Shaker Dome and carefully position it on to the Seaside Spray card mat.  Then you can adhere the whole piece on to the White card mat.

To finish stamp the base in Smoky Slate and cut that with the die and raise that up off the card with Dimensionals.  Stamp the sentiment from the set on to scrap white card and cut this with the Ornate Frames Dies and also cut one in the Silver Glimmer Paper.  Cut the silver one in half and adhere that behind the white one to off-set it . Adhere that on to the card and add a bow from the Seaside Spray Metallic Ribbon.

WEDNESDAY’S WOW! #90 – SHINY DIECUTS!

Wednesday’s WOW! #90 – creating shiny diecuts.  This is something really cool I just realised. Maybe you already know.  This is how you can make your diecuts shiny – and not using the shiny Foil or sparkling Glimmer Paper.  It’s very easy.

Firstly, diecut your shape.  Here I used the leaf shape from the Christmas Layers Dies.  Rub over the diecut with Versamark, Sprinkle over the Clear Embossing Powder and heat the powder with your Heat Tool.  See the shine develop.  It’s always magical isn’t it when you see that powder melt away.  If you want to take it a step further you could add some glitter in with it to really make it sparkle.  How cool!

Below is the finished card.

I had a small piece of the Brightly Gleaming Specialty Designer Series Paper.  Before I adhered this to the white card mat I stamped over some “spots” from the Christmas Gleaming stamp set and then embossed the white card with the Subtles Embossing Powder.  It is a little hard to see. 

Add a small strip of the Copper Foil behind your Brightly Gleaming paper strip too before adding it to the card. Adhere the leaf spray on to the white card and then add this to the Pretty Peacock card base.  The sentiment is from the Christmas Gleaming stamp set stamped on to white card and that was cut out.  All finished with a Copper Star Embellishment and some of the Classic Weave Ribbon added with a glue dot.

#ELFIE PAIR!

I have to say the little #Elfie set is kinda cute don’t you think.

Recently I stamped up a few images when I visited a friend and just managed to colour them and make up the cards on the weekend.  I thought I would show you.

I had some “bits” of the Wrapped in Plaid Designer Series Paper hanging around and thought I should try and use those rather than cut in to another full piece.  The Wrapped in Plaid Paper does have Cherry Cobbler and Shaded Spruce colours in it but I think the Real Red colour still works well with it.   The images were coloured with the Stampin’ Blends. 

For the first one I cut down some of the strips of the paper to add them to the white card mat.  I added some sparkly Red Glimmer Paper and the Real Red Satin Ribbon.  The sentiment is from the Itty Bitty Christmas stamp set.

This next one I added a small strip of the Gold Foil behind the paper and layered it on to a Real Red Card mat.  The stamped image was cut with the Rectangles Stitched dies.  I think the sentiment is appropriate for this cute elf.  This is from the Itty Bitty Christmas set too and it was layered with the Gold Foil Diecut frame from the Ornate Frames Dies.

STAMPING AROUND THE WORLD BLOGHOP – BRIGHTLY GLEAMING!

It’s time for another Stamping Around The World Blog Hop. You might have come from Sue’s Blog ->HERE.

Today I have a card using the Brightly Gleaming Suite for you.  This is a Flap Fold style of card.

The card was inspired by one that was shared on Lee Ann’s blog -> HERE. I will give you the measurements below though before you are on your way to the next blog.

FLAP FOLD CARD

Card Base: 10.5cm x 14.8cm  (4 1/4″ x 5 1/4″)

Night of Navy card: 8.5cm x 21cm scored at 10.5cm  (3 1/4″ x 8 1/2″ scored at 4 1/4″)

Designer Series Paper: 8.1cm x 10.1cm ( 3″ x 4″)

Whisper White card (inside): 8.1cm x 10.1cm (3″ x 4″)

Scrap card for stamping ornaments and Copper Foil for Stitched Circle.

 

The base card is a single piece with the “flap” of card of Night of Navy adhered on to the top.

It is such an easy fold of card to make.  I hope you get to try one yourself.
